Berkshire pub-restaurant with rooms on the market

by Angela Frewin, Wednesday 7th March 2007 14:07

New owners are being sought for a Berkshire pub with a restaurant and three en-suite bedrooms.

The Fox & Horn in Mortimer, near Reading, offers a 20-seat bar, a 36-seat restaurant and a 24-seat function room.

The rooms feature decorative period dado and picture rails, exposed ceiling beams, open fireplaces and flagstone flooring.

Outside, there is parking for 30 cars and extensive gardens with a large lawn terrace that can house a marquee for events.

The owners’ accommodation provides a bedroom, a bathroom, a lounge and an office.

Oxford-based Davey & Co is seeking offers in the region of £99,000 for the leasehold.
